Bicycling
The overall level of difficulty is easy to moderate. Most days are between 30 to 35 miles of riding
with a few exceptions. There are a few hills, but they are not steep and mostly not very long.
On the second day of the two-night stays we can adjust the schedule depending on ambition.
Walking or taking a boat on these days is optional.
Pricing
Trip price includes 5 dinners and all breakfasts, accommodations in 4-star hotels; 4 two-night stays and 1 one-night stay.
